.header{display:flex;flex-direction:row;align-items:center;justify-content:space-between;padding:1rem;border-bottom:.25rem solid #4a4a4a}.header nav ul{list-style:none;padding:0;display:flex;gap:20px}.header nav ul li{display:inline-block}.header nav ul li a{display:block;padding:10px 20px;text-decoration:none;font-weight:900;text-transform:uppercase;font-family:jetbrains mono,monospace;color:#4a4a4a;background-color:#fff;border:4px solid #4a4a4a;box-shadow:5px 5px #4a4a4a;transition:all .1s ease-in-out}.header nav ul li a:hover{transform:translate(-3px,-3px);box-shadow:8px 8px #4a4a4a}.header nav ul li a:active{transform:translate(5px,5px);box-shadow:0 0 #4a4a4a}.logo-box{display:inline-block;text-decoration:none;background-color:#f0eee9;padding:8px 16px}.logo-box .logo-text{color:#4a4a4a;font-family:jetbrains mono,monospace;font-weight:900;font-size:2rem;letter-spacing:-1px;text-transform:uppercase}.footer{display:flex;flex-direction:column;align-items:center;justify-content:space-between;padding-top:1rem;border-top:.25rem solid #4a4a4a;margin-top:2rem}.footer nav ul{list-style:none;padding:0;display:flex;gap:20px}.footer nav ul li{display:inline-block}.footer nav ul li a{display:block;padding:10px 20px;text-decoration:none;font-weight:900;text-transform:uppercase;font-family:jetbrains mono,monospace;color:#4a4a4a;background-color:#fff;border:4px solid #4a4a4a;box-shadow:5px 5px #4a4a4a;transition:all .1s ease-in-out}.footer nav ul li a:hover{transform:translate(-3px,-3px);box-shadow:8px 8px #4a4a4a}.footer nav ul li a:active{transform:translate(5px,5px);box-shadow:0 0 #4a4a4a}.footer p{font-weight:900;font-family:jetbrains mono,monospace;color:#4a4a4a}.brutalist-card{background-color:#fff;padding:20px;max-width:350px;border:4px;box-shadow:8px 8px #4a4a4a;transition:all .1s ease}.brutalist-card:hover{transform:translate(-2px,-2px);box-shadow:10px 10px #4a4a4a}.brutalist-card .card-header{border-bottom:2px solid #4a4a4a;padding-bottom:10px;margin-bottom:15px}.brutalist-card .card-header .badge{display:inline-block;background:#4a4a4a;color:#f0eee9;font-size:.7rem;padding:2px 8px;font-weight:900;text-transform:uppercase;margin-bottom:5px}.brutalist-card .card-header .card-title{margin:0;font-size:1.5rem;text-transform:uppercase}.brutalist-card .card-body .description{font-size:.9rem;line-height:1.4;margin-bottom:15px}.brutalist-card .card-body .tag-list{display:flex;flex-wrap:wrap;gap:8px;list-style:none;padding:0;font-family:jetbrains mono,monospace;font-weight:700;font-size:.8rem}.brutalist-card .card-footer{margin-top:20px}.brutalist-card .card-footer .btn-action{display:block;text-align:center;background:#4a4a4a;color:#fff;text-decoration:none;padding:10px;font-weight:900;border:2px solid #4a4a4a}.brutalist-card .card-footer .btn-action:hover{background:#fff;color:#4a4a4a}.brutal-box-wrapper{padding:2%;display:flex;justify-content:center;flex-direction:row;align-items:center;gap:2rem;min-height:fit-content}.brutal-box{background-color:#fff;padding:2rem;display:flex;justify-content:center;gap:2rem;overflow:hidden;pointer-events:auto;border:4px solid #4a4a4a;box-shadow:8px 8px #4a4a4a;transition:all .1s ease;box-shadow:10px 10px #4a4a4a;color:#4a4a4a;font-family:jetbrains mono,monospace;transition:all .1s ease-in-out}.brutal-box-content{padding:1rem}.brutal-box-content ul{list-style-type:square}.brutal-box .brutal-title{text-transform:uppercase;font-weight:900;margin-top:0;border-bottom:3px solid #4a4a4a;padding-bottom:.5rem}.brutal-box:active{transform:translate(10px,10px);box-shadow:0 0 #4a4a4a}.brutal-btn{margin-top:1rem;background:#4a4a4a;color:#f0eee9;border:none;padding:10px 20px;font-weight:700;cursor:pointer;text-transform:uppercase}.brutal-btn:hover{filter:brightness(1.2)}.brutal-image{width:auto;height:auto;object-fit:cover;border:4px solid #4a4a4a;box-shadow:8px 8px #4a4a4a;transition:all .1s ease}.brutal-image img{max-height:456px;width:300px;aspect-ratio:3/4;object-fit:cover;image-rendering:pixelated}.brutal-socials{margin-top:2rem;display:flex;gap:1.5rem;justify-content:flex-start}.brutal-socials a{border:3px solid #4a4a4a;box-shadow:8px 8px #4a4a4a;transition:all .1s ease}.brutal-socials a:hover{transform:translate(-2px,-2px);box-shadow:10px 10px #4a4a4a}.brutal-socials a{color:#4a4a4a;background-color:#fff;font-size:1.5rem;transition:transform .2s ease-in-out;padding:.5rem 1rem}.brutal-socials a:hover{transform:scale(1.2);border:3px solid #4a4a4a;box-shadow:8px 8px #4a4a4a;transition:all .1s ease}.brutal-socials a:hover:hover{transform:translate(-2px,-2px);box-shadow:10px 10px #4a4a4a}.brutal-socials a i{background:#fff}.slider-wrapper{display:flex;flex-direction:column;gap:1.5rem;width:100%;max-width:1400px;margin:0 auto}.slider-container{display:flex;align-items:center;justify-content:center;gap:1rem;width:100%;max-width:1400px;margin:0 auto}.brutal-slider{width:100%;height:400px;background-color:#f0eee9}::ng-deep .brutal-slider .swiper-wrapper{height:100%;align-items:stretch}::ng-deep .brutal-slider .swiper-slide{height:100%;display:flex;overflow:visible}.slide-content{min-height:100%;display:flex;flex-direction:column;justify-content:center;align-items:center;background-color:#fff;padding:1.5rem;text-align:center;position:relative;box-sizing:border-box;box-shadow:8px 8px #4a4a4a;border:4px solid #4a4a4a;box-shadow:8px 8px #4a4a4a;transition:all .1s ease}.slide-content h2{margin:0 0 .75rem;font-size:1.5rem;font-weight:900;text-transform:uppercase;color:#4a4a4a;font-family:jetbrains mono,monospace;border-bottom:3px solid #4a4a4a;padding-bottom:.5rem}.slide-content p{margin:0;font-size:.9rem;line-height:1.6;color:#4a4a4a;font-family:jetbrains mono,monospace}.slider-navigation{display:flex;justify-content:center;gap:1rem;width:100%}.slider-nav-btn{width:60px;height:60px;background-color:#fff;border:4px solid #4a4a4a;color:#4a4a4a;font-weight:900;font-size:2rem;font-family:jetbrains mono,monospace;cursor:pointer;display:flex;align-items:center;justify-content:center;flex-shrink:0;padding:0;box-shadow:6px 6px #4a4a4a;transition:all .1s ease-in-out}.slider-nav-btn .material-icons{font-size:1.5rem;display:flex;align-items:center;justify-content:center;background-color:#fff}.slider-nav-btn:hover{transform:translate(-3px,-3px);box-shadow:9px 9px #4a4a4a}.slider-nav-btn:active{transform:translate(6px,6px);box-shadow:0 0 #4a4a4a}.slider-nav-btn:disabled{opacity:.5;cursor:not-allowed}.slider-nav-btn i{background-color:#fff}::ng-deep .swiper-button-next,::ng-deep .swiper-button-prev{display:none!important}::ng-deep .swiper-pagination-bullet{width:12px;height:12px;background-color:#4a4a4a;opacity:1;border:2px solid #4a4a4a}::ng-deep .swiper-pagination-bullet.swiper-pagination-bullet-active{background-color:#4a4a4a;box-shadow:0 0 0 3px #f0eee9,0 0 0 5px #4a4a4a}*{background-color:#f0eee9;color:#4a4a4a}